Architecture Studies and System Demonstrations of Optical Parallel Processor for AI and NI
Abstract
During the contract period, we have studied architecture, algorithm, and system issues pertaining to the implementation of optoelectronic technology for Artificial Intelligence (AI) and Neural Intelligence (NI). As a result, we have developed the Programmable Opto-Electronic Multiprocessor (POEM) system. We have demonstrated the superiority of the POEM architecture over VLSI and other optical systems in many applications. We have developed or modified parallel AI algorithms for efficient implementation on POEM. Finally, we are currently assembling a prototype POEM system and subsystems necessary for future POEM systems.
